This biennial conference presents the critical advances in basic, clinical and operational research that move science into policy and practice.

Through its open and inclusive programme development, the meeting sets the gold standard of HIV research featuring highly diverse and cutting-edge studies.

IAS 2021 participants can expect a full conference experience via an easy-to-use digital platform that connects researchers, healthcare providers, advocates and policy makers.

Additionally, the IAS 2021 Berlin Hub will convene in the original host city of Berlin, in accordance with local health advice and regulations.

IAS – the International AIDS Society – leads collective action on every front of the global HIV response through its membership base, scientific authority and convening power.

Founded in 1988, the IAS is the world’s largest association of HIV professionals, with members in more than 170 countries. Working with its members, the IAS advocates and drives urgent action to reduce the impact of HIV. The IAS is also the steward of the world’s most prestigious HIV conferences: the International AIDS Conference, the IAS Conference on HIV Science, and the HIV Research for Prevention Conference. In light of the SARS-CoV-2 pandemic, the IAS also convened two abstract driven COVID-19 conferences, in July 2020 and February 2021.
